We reported earlier this week (via TMZ) that WWE is taking aggressive measures to prevent bootleggers from selling fraudulent WWE merchandise during WrestleMania weekend in New Orleans.

WWE filed legal documents in Louisiana this week trying to get a temporary restraining order to ban bootleggers from selling unauthorized merchandise outside the Mercedes Benz Superdome and the Smoothie King Center.

WWE submitted several merchandise designs and trademarks – and one of the documents includes a photo of the yet-to-be-announced WWE Cruiserweight Tag Team Championships. WWE is expected to introduce the new Cruiserweight tag team titles after WrestleMania 34.
